About 4-methyl-3-[3-[4-[(4-methylpiperazin-1-yl)methyl]phenyl]-1H-indazol-6-yl]-N-[3-(trifluoromethyl)phenyl]benzamide

4-methyl-3-[3-[4-[(4-methylpiperazin-1-yl)methyl]phenyl]-1H-indazol-6-yl]-N-[3-(trifluoromethyl)phenyl]benzamide (PubChem CID 155532218) has the molecular formula C34H32F3N5O and a molecular weight of 583.66 g/mol. Its IUPAC name is 4-methyl-3-[3-[4-[(4-methylpiperazin-1-yl)methyl]phenyl]-1H-indazol-6-yl]-N-[3-(trifluoromethyl)phenyl]benzamide.
